Problem:
When working with Excel spreadsheets that contain workbook links, you may run into the following error:
This error happens when some users in an organization have added Box as a Connected Service in Microsoft Office, while others have not.
When users who do not have Box added as a Connected Service within Microsoft Office work with an Excel spreadsheet with workbook links, Excel will attempt to update the workbook links to reflect the local Box Drive path. With Co-Authoring enabled for the organization, Excel appends the local filesystem path to the WOPI URL, creating a broken link.
When users who do have Box added as a Connected Service within Microsoft Office work with the same file, they will encounter this error for the broken link.
Process for Resolution:
To resolve this error, follow the steps outlined below.
- Ensure that all managed users in your organization are enabled for Box for Microsoft Office Co-Authoring.
- Admin Console > Integrations > Box for Microsoft Office Co-Authoring

- Ensure that all managed users in your organization have added Box as a Connected Service in Microsoft Office and have signed into their Box accounts.
- Office App > File > Account > Connected Services

- Have users manually update the broken links.
